At the eastern edge of Pera Galini beach , the small cape Kefali Soudas is formed. The ruins of a Minoan settlement, which is thought to have been one of the most important ports in the region of Talea Range , have been discovered there.

On Kefali , you will see the excavations with plastic covers reminding of greenhouses, which are still in progress and have brought a sanctuary to light. It is considered that the settlement was destroyed by an earthquake.

Access in the fenced archaeological site is prohibited.
